Take a moment to ponder your past twenty four hours; think for just a few moments about how many things you did during that twenty four hour period that required you taking care of somebody else’s needs, wants or desires. Now:

•Grab a pen and your journal.
•Escape to a quiet, peaceful place in your home. The bathroom is a great escape destination.
•Make note of all the events that took place in the past 24 hours which involved you doing something for someone else.
•Remember all the tiny occasions along with the big events; note each and every one of them.
•When you have completed your list sit back and admire your ability to care for others.

When you have taken some time to revel in the amount that you do for others on a regular basis, pat yourself on your back and it is now time to move on. At this moment in time I would now like you to create a second list. This list will be made up of any and everything that you did in the past twenty four hours only for you, nobody else except yourself. Follow the same procedure as the first activity. When you reach the end of your list making, be sure to contemplate your array of events.

If you are like most Lovely Ladies who have participated in this activity, you more likely than not have created a massive list of what you did for others and a quite significantly smaller one when it comes to doing things for yourself. Think about how you could begin to create more space for you, consider small efforts in the self department and make it a point to create more balance between the two lists.
